FRONT BRAKE
4-16
a. Blow compressed air into the brake hose
joint opening to force out the piston from the
brake caliper.
EWA13550
WARNING
Cover the brake caliper piston with a cloth.
Be careful not to get injured when the pis
-
ton is expelled from the brake caliper.
Do not use a screwdriver etc. for removing
the brake caliper piston.
b. Remove the brake caliper piston dust seal
and the brake caliper piston seal.

CHECKING THE FRONT BRAKE CALIPER
1. Check:
Brake caliper piston “1”
Rust/scratches/wear Replace the brake
caliper piston.
Brake caliper cylinder “2”
Scratches/wear Replace the brake cali-
per assembly.
Brake caliper body “3”
Cracks/damage Replace the brake cali-
per assembly.
Brake fluid delivery passages
(brake caliper body)
Obstruction Blow out with compressed
air.
EWA13600
WARNING
When the brake caliper is disassembled, re-
place the brake caliper piston seal and the
brake caliper piston dust seal with new
ones.
2. Check:
Brake caliper bracket
Crack/damage Replace.

ASSEMBLING THE FRONT BRAKE CALI-
PER
EWA13620
WARNING
Before installation, clean and lubricate the
internal parts. Use new brake fluid for
cleaning and lubricating.
Never use solvents on internal brake com-
ponents as they will cause the piston seals
to swell and distort.
When the brake caliper is disassembled,
replace the brake caliper piston seal and
the brake caliper piston dust seal with new
ones.

INSTALLING THE BRAKE CALIPER PISTON
1. Clean:
Brake caliper
Brake caliper piston seal
Brake caliper piston dust seal
Brake caliper piston
Use brake fluid for cleaning.
2. Install:
Brake caliper piston seals “1”
Brake caliper piston dust seal “2”
EWA33DD033
WARNING
Always use new brake caliper piston seal
and brake caliper piston dust seal.
TIP
Apply the brake fluid on the brake caliper pis-
ton seal.
Apply the silicone grease on the brake caliper
piston dust seal.
Fit the brake caliper piston seal and the brake
caliper piston dust seal into the grooves in the
brake caliper correctly.
